Meet Riggs IS ADOPTED

Updated October 17th..Introducing Riggs...WHAT A GREAT DOG. He is very handsome, very friendly, very kind, silly, 2-3 year old boy with a beautiful silky, shiney black coat and breathtaking brown eyes, he is much smaller then he appears weighing 50-55 pounds. His tail is a little fluffy and his fur is short like a lab, but a little thicker with a bit more depth. He This dog is really, really sweet, and just wants to be loved. In the video Riggs is the black lab mix with the green bandana on. You will begin to see him about 37 seconds into the video. Note how much smaller he really is in the video.



Riggs spent a couple days with me and let me tell you he is a great dog with tons of bouncy energy. He is great with the other dogs, the kitties, and fabulous with children. He would do really, really well with an active family and/or a family with active children. He is a huge snuggler. He jumped on the couch and very slowly crawled over to me, making sure it was o.k., to rest his head on my lap or gently moving my arm so he could snuggle under it. What a great, loving dog. Very sweet, and full of kisses. We have not seen any signs of food, toy or bone aggression, he could use some leash work, but he is very smart and learns quickly. He takes a treat very nicely and will even sit for it.



Riggs when to an adoption event and did really well with the younger children..he even kissed a baby. The foster mom who attended the adoption event with Riggs said this…”Riggs was given a bully stick to chew on and he showed no indication of resource guarding around people. People were petting him and he just chewed. He let me take it out of his mouth without a problem. He is an active dog and would make a terrific running or walking partner. He would also make a terrific pet for someone who active, playful children.



This beautiful lap dog rides very well in a car, and will happily sit in the passenger seat if you let me. No motion sickness seen and he really liked looking out the window or having it down. We have not observed any destructive chewing, but given his age of 2-3, he is probably past that already.



Riggs was rescued from Kendall County Animal Control when his days were up. Soooo glad we did as he is terrific!
